Thank you for the report, I can reproduce the bug using j701 linux. This is caused by a commit some months ago
tara: kludge for xlscsv which has trouble to read small block Basically it adds some junk data if the size of excel file written is very small. The file will still be ok for gnumeric but tara detect the inconsistency and rejects it. A possible fix is to disable that check in Tara.
